Assisted Living Costs in Opelika, AL

When it comes to exploring assisted living options in Opelika, AL, it's important to consider the associated costs. Understanding the financial implications can help you make an informed decision for yourself or your loved ones.

Assisted living costs in Opelika, AL can vary depending on a variety of factors. These may include the level of care required, the location of the facility, and the amenities provided. To give you an idea, the average cost of assisted living in Opelika, AL ranges from approximately $2,500 to $4,000 per month.

It's worth noting that these costs must be compared to the overall cost of living in the Opelika area. The cost of housing, groceries, transportation, and other expenses should be taken into consideration when evaluating the affordability of assisted living.

For those who may need financial support, there are programs available in Opelika, AL that can help alleviate some of the costs associated with assisted living. Taking advantage of these programs can make assisted living more accessible and affordable for those who qualify.

It's also essential to consider the proximity to medical facilities when choosing an assisted living community. In Opelika, AL, the East Alabama Medical Center is the primary hospital serving the area. Having a hospital nearby provides peace of mind, knowing that medical care is readily available if needed.

In conclusion, when considering assisted living options in Opelika, AL, it's important to factor in the associated costs and compare them to the overall cost of living in the area. By exploring available support programs and ensuring easy access to medical facilities like the East Alabama Medical Center, you can make a well-informed decision that suits your needs and budget. 

How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Opelika, AL

When it comes to finding the right assisted living community in Opelika, AL, it's important to understand the qualifications that may be required. These qualifications can vary depending on the specific community and the level of care needed, so it's essential to do your research and gather the necessary information.

Here are some key requirements to consider when looking to qualify for assisted living in Opelika, AL:

1. Age and Health Status: Most assisted living communities have a minimum age requirement, typically around 55 or 60 years old. Additionally, they may assess the individual's health status to ensure that the level of care provided meets their needs. It's important to provide any medical documentation or assessments to support your eligibility.

2. Activities of Daily Living (ADLs): ADLs refer to basic self-care tasks such as bathing, dressing, meal preparation, and mobility. Assisted living communities usually assess an applicant's ability to perform these activities independently or with minimal assistance. If you require assistance with any ADLs, it's important to document this information.

3. Cognitive Functioning: Some assisted living communities will also evaluate an individual's cognitive functioning. This assessment helps determine if the level of care provided aligns with any memory issues or impairments. Be prepared to provide relevant medical evaluations or reports if memory concerns are present.

4. Financial Resources: Assisted living communities often have specific financial requirements, such as proof of income or assets. These requirements are put in place to ensure that residents can afford the cost of living in the community. It's important to inquire about the specific financial qualifications for the Opelika, AL area and gather the necessary documents to support your application.

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Opelika, AL

When it comes to finding the right place to live during your golden years or choosing a suitable home for your elderly loved ones, Opelika, Alabama has some excellent options for assisted living. It's important to weigh the advantages and disadvantages of such a decision to ensure the best possible experience for everyone involved. In this blog post, we will delve into the unique features and considerations of assisted living in Opelika, AL.

Advantages of Assisted Living in Opelika, AL:

1. Welcoming Community: Opelika prides itself on its friendly and tight-knit community. Assisted living facilities in this city often foster a warm and inclusive environment, offering opportunities for socializing and making new friends.

2. Access to Healthcare: Opelika is home to various reputable healthcare facilities, ensuring that residents of assisted living communities have easy access to medical attention when needed. This can provide peace of mind for both residents and their families.

3. Recreational Opportunities: Opelika boasts a myriad of recreational activities and attractions suitable for seniors. From picturesque parks and nature trails to senior-friendly clubs and events, there is no shortage of opportunities to engage in hobbies and stay active.

Disadvantages of Assisted Living in Opelika, AL:

1. Limited Options: While Opelika offers quality assisted living facilities, the variety and number of options may be relatively limited compared to bigger cities. This could result in longer waitlists or a reduced chance of finding a facility that perfectly matches specific preferences.

2. Weather Considerations: Opelika experiences hot and humid summers, which may not be ideal for everyone, especially those who prefer milder temperatures. Seniors with certain health conditions may find it necessary to take extra precautions during these warmer months.

List of 10 Best Assisted Living Facilities in Opelika, AL

Northridge Specialty Care Assisted Living Facility

While looking for assisted living in Opelika, Alabama, you may come across Northridge Specialty Care Assisted Living Facility, located at 801 Morris Avenue in the 36803 zip code area in Lee County. Northridge Specialty Care Assisted Living Facility assists senior citizens living in Opelika who require assistance with bathing, putting on clothes, getting in and out of bed, eating by themselves, styling their hair and using the toilet. Northridge Specialty Care Assisted Living Facility includes services like: fitness activities, housekeeping and emptying trash and mealtime assistance.

East Alabama Medical Center Skilled Nursing Facility

East Alabama Medical Center Skilled Nursing Facility is an affordable assisted senior living facility located in Opelika, Alabama. It has a total of 26 assisted living units. East Alabama Medical Center Skilled Nursing Facility can be found at 2000 Pepperell Parkway, in the 36802 zip code area. It provides help to elderly adults living in Lee County with ADLs such as taking a shower and assistance with dressing. Some features you can find at East Alabama Medical Center Skilled Nursing Facility include pharmacy service, housekeeping and emptying trash and pet-friendly facilities.

Arbor Springs Health And Rehab Center

Situated at 1910 Pepperell Parkway, inside 36801 zip code area, Arbor Springs Health And Rehab Center provides assisted living in Opelika, AL to elderly adults who live in Lee County. Arbor Springs Health And Rehab Center provides services that consist of fitness center, laundry services and special dietary accommodation. It can provide board and care to up to 225 Lee County residents.

Manor House Of Opelika

Manor House Of Opelika is a pet friendly senior assisted living facility located at 1001 Fox Run Parkway, 36801 zip code. Up to 36 55 and older adults who need a personal care home in Lee County can take advantage of senior living services offered by Manor House Of Opelika. This senior care home offers services such as help with relocation and pet-friendly facilities, medication supervision, and private dining area.

Camellia Place At Auburn Medical Park

Camellia Place At Auburn Medical Park provides assisted living in Lee county, Alabama. It offers a total of 42 shared and private one bedrooms and studios for seniors. Camellia Place At Auburn Medical Park offers amenities that include concierge services and medication monitoring, and it can also provide assistance with bathing, dressing, functional mobility, self-feeding, combing or brushing their hair and using the toilet to any retirees living in Auburn, AL and Lee County. Camellia Place At Auburn Medical Park is located at 1171 Gatewood Drive, Building 206, 36830.

Magnolia Place Specialty Care Assisted Living Facility

For senior citizens who are searching for assisted living in Auburn, Alabama, Magnolia Place Specialty Care Assisted Living Facility is a great luxury residential care facility that offers a library and three meals per day. It has a total capacity of 42 assisted living apartments and also offers weight management. Its official license number is P4102. Magnolia Place Specialty Care Assisted Living Facility offers assisted living services not only to Auburn senior citizens, but also to all Lee County residents.

Morningside Of Auburn

If your loved one needs aid with daily living assistance, you should consider Morningside Of Auburn, an assisted living community in Auburn, Alabama located at 871 Twin Forks Avenue, 36830 zip code area. It provides services such as available transportation, 24 hour staff and transportation. Morningside Of Auburn provides assisted living in Lee County to up to 49 elderly adults.

Azalea Place Assisted Living Facility

Azalea Place Assisted Living Facility provides assisted living services in Lee County to up to 56 elderly adults at a time. Azalea Place Assisted Living Facility is situated at 1601 Professional Parkway in the 36830 zip code area. As part of it individual care services, it includes amenities like a bistro, custom needs assessment and personalized service plan.

Lakewood Senior Living Of Smith

Lakewood Senior Living Of Smith, located at 3020 Lee Road 430, Smiths, Alabama, 36877 provides assisted living for elderly adults residing in Lee County and surrounding areas. Lakewood Senior Living Of Smith has a maximum capacity of 16 assisted living residences. A few of its features include health monitoring and parking service.

Oak Park

Oak Park is an assisted living facility in Auburn, Alabama, providing services and care to retirees who need assistance with taking a bath or shower, dressing, getting in and out of bed, self feeding and using the bathroom. Its maximum accommodation capacity is 87 assisted living units. Oak Park includes services such as private dining, on-site dietitian and ambulation services.
